Cobalt barometer - a plaster model of the Amphitheater in Nîmes from France, with its upper part coated in cobalt solution. Traditionally, the cobalt surface of such a barometer would signal the weather by changing color: it remained blue in good weather, turned pink in variable conditions, and shifted to gray when snow or a cold front was imminent.
